Position Overview:
Are you a dynamic and passionate sales professional? Do you excel at building strong client relationships and have a keen understanding of the rental market? If so, we want you on our team!
As an Outside Rental Sales Representative, you will be at the forefront of our rental sales initiatives within your designated accounts or territories. Your role will be pivotal in driving new rental business and providing top-notch service to our existing clients.
Job Description:
Key Responsibilities:
- Present and sell rental products and services to current and potential clients, emphasizing the benefits and features of the rental fleet.
- Follow up on new leads and referrals resulting from field activity, focusing on rental opportunities.
- Identify rental sales prospects and contact these and other accounts as assigned.
- Prepare presentations, proposals, and rental agreements while maintaining sales materials and current product knowledge.
- Identify and resolve client concerns related to rental services, ensuring a smooth rental experience.
- Prepare various status reports, including activity, closings, follow-up, and adherence to rental sales goals.
- Communicate new rental product and service opportunities, special developments, information, or feedback gathered through field activity to appropriate company staff.
- Participate in marketing events such as seminars, trade shows, and telemarketing events, with a focus on promoting rental services.
- Develop and maintain effective working relationships within the team and with other teams.
- Commit to continuous learning and development, particularly in the rental market.
- Minimum 3-5+ years of territory sales experience required, with a focus on rental sales.
- Excellent customer service skills and good knowledge of rental market strategies and planning.
- Ability to apply logical thinking to a wide range of problems, collect data, draw conclusions, and offer constructive opinions concerning day-to-day rental activities.
- Understanding of construction phases, job situations, and project conditions for the timing of approaching customers and rental product application suggestions.
- Knowledgeable of the entire rental fleet and able to demonstrate equipment whenever appropriate to increase customer awareness of rental offerings and applications.
- Proficient in Microsoft Outlook and basic computer operations.
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to persuade and influence others, develop and deliver presentations, and create, compose, and edit written materials.
- Knowledge of advertising and sales promotion techniques, with previous experience with CRM tools.
